Output 592d5b5eac2ec760621505aa4ad08a3259aec3bc00a656ebf06f14111023a075:11

value
1420053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8414ba2440804bf1275fc26bd4bd64d13c407889 OP_EQUAL
address
3DjPx1ZxLSTRF9m4kwpczUo6uVBksXae6g
transaction
592d5b5eac2ec760621505aa4ad08a3259aec3bc00a656ebf06f14111023a075
confirmations
231892
spent
true